The first stop is in Certaldo, an enchanting Medieval village renowned as Boccaccio’s birthplace. This ancient village, located on the Via Francigena, as many Tuscan towns is divided in two parts, one modern and one medieval, located on the top of a hill. Stroll along the cozy narrow streets of the city center will be a real pleasure!

Left Certaldo, the tour will reach the Etruscan town of Volterra, famous all over the world for the alabaster craft. Visit by your own of this magic and mysterious city, which origins date more than 3000 years ago. It is possible to find evidence and traces from every historical period, which gives the artistic city a unique aspect. You will be able to admire the ancient city walls, the charming Porta dell’Arco, the Roman Amphitheatre, the Cathedral and the wonderful Piazza dei Priori, located in the heart of the old town. Here you will have a delicious lunch in a typical Trattoria located in the centre of Volterra.

In the afternoon, the third stop is San Gimignano, a gorgeous town declared UNESCO World Heritage, where you‘ll be given free time to visit the medieval town planning with the numerous and beautiful towers hence the name "Manhattan of the Middle Ages". The village is also known for the famous "Vernaccia" white wine here produced. A stroll in the town center means discovering true jewels of art, among which Piazza della Cisterna, the Dome, Palazzo del Podestà and the Church of Sant'Agostino.
